ABSTRACT

Introduction:

Airway management is a crucial skill for theclinical anaesthesiologist. It is an integral part of generalanesthesia, allowing ventilation and oxygenation as wellas a mode for anesthetic gas delivery. The laryngeal maskairways(LMA) have become popular in airway managementas a missing link between facemask and tracheal tube interms of both anatomical position and degree of invasiveness.Haemodynamic stability is an important aspect to theanaesthesiologist for the benefit of the patients especiallyduring intubations, laryngeal mask insertion. Laryngoscopyand endotracheal intubation can cause striking changes inHaemodynamics as result of intense stimulation of sympatheticnervous system. The aim of this study was to evaluate thehemodynamic changes between endotracheal intubation andlaryngeal mask airway insertion.Material and

Methods:

This was a prospective observationalstudy on 46 patients of ASA I-II status divided into 2 groups of23 each. In the ETT (Endotracheal tube) group endotrachealintubation was done using Macintosh laryngoscope by usingportex cuffed endotracheal while in LMA (Laryngeal maskairway) group laryngeal mask airway was inserted accordingto the standard recommendation. Heart rate, Systolic, Diastolicand Mean arterial pressure and dysrhythmias were monitored.

Results:

The two groups were comparable in terms ofdemographic data as there were no significant differencesbetween the 2 groups in terms of age, sex, duration of surgery,ASA grades and MPC classification. Heart rate (HR), Systolicblood pressure (SBP), Diastolic blood pressure(DBP), Meanarterial pressure (MAP) remains on higher side in ETT groupthan LMA group which was statistically significant. P<0.05.Dysrhythmias were noted in 2 patients of ETT group whileLMA group did not notice any dysrhythmias.

Conclusion:

This study demonstrated that there is ahaemodynamic response consisting of an increase in Heartrate, SBP, DBP and MAP that comes with ETT insertion aswell as with LMA insertion. However, the response causedby ETT insertion is significantly greater than that caused byLMA insertion.
